About This Opportunity
At Lloyds Banking Group, were committed to helping Britain prosper. Our Workplace team plays a vital role in supporting customers as they save for retirement, ensuring our products deliver real value and meet evolving needs. As part of this collaborative and forward-thinking team, youll be at the heart of our mission to deliver great customer outcomes, while embedding Consumer Duty principles into everything we do.
This dual-hatted role offers a unique opportunity to develop your expertise across both product governance and risk management. Youll work closely with colleagues across Risk, Product, and Compliance, using data insights to monitor performance, identify risks and drive improvements. If youre passionate about doing the right thing for customers and want to grow your career in a dynamic, purpose-led environment, wed love to hear from you.
Key Accountabilities
Monitor and analyse customer data to ensure workplace pension products deliver fair value and good outcomes.
Identify risks and issues across the end-to-end customer journey and support the development of action plans.
Develop and maintain key MI and KPIs to enhance Consumer Duty compliance and product oversight.
Support change governance by assessing customer, regulatory and commercial impacts of proposed changes.
Maintain the Workplace Risk profile, including oversight of action plans, controls and risk events.
Prepare and present committee and board papers, offering insights from ongoing product monitoring.

What Youll Need
Analytical experience within a financial institution, with the ability to interpret and work with data sets, using tools like Excel to draw insights and influence decision making.
Excellent written and verbal communication skills, with the ability to present findings clearly and confidently to a range of stakeholders.
Proven stakeholder management skills, with experience in building collaborative relationships and influencing across different teams and levels.
A proactive approach to problem-solving, with validated ability to identify risk and opportunity across customer journeys and product performance.
Awareness of key FCA regulations including ICOB, CoB, PROD, PRIN and Consumer Duty, and how they apply to product governance.
And this would be beneficial:
A solid understanding of LBG Conduct and Compliance policies, particularly around Product Governance and Consumer Duty.
Some knowledge of workplace pension products and the broader retirement savings landscape.
